How to Get Bitcoin Wallet QR Code: A Step-by-Step Guide

In today's digital age, cryptocurrencies have gained immense popularity, with Bitcoin being the most well-known and widely used digital currency. One of the most convenient ways to receive Bitcoin is through a QR code. A Bitcoin wallet QR code is a unique barcode that allows users to receive Bitcoin payments without the need for manual input of the recipient's Bitcoin address. In this article, we will provide a step-by-step guide on how to get a Bitcoin wallet QR code.
Step 1: Choose a Bitcoin Wallet
The first step in obtaining a Bitcoin wallet QR code is to select a Bitcoin wallet. There are various types of Bitcoin wallets available, including mobile, desktop, and hardware wallets. Each type has its own advantages and disadvantages, so it's essential to choose one that suits your needs.
Mobile wallets are convenient for on-the-go users, while desktop wallets offer more control and security. Hardware wallets, on the other hand, are considered the most secure option, as they store your private keys offline.
Step 2: Create a Bitcoin Wallet Account
Once you have chosen a Bitcoin wallet, you need to create an account. This process usually involves providing your email address and setting a password. Some wallets may require additional verification steps, such as phone number confirmation or two-factor authentication, to enhance security.
Step 3: Generate a Bitcoin Address
After creating your Bitcoin wallet account, you will need to generate a Bitcoin address. This address is a unique string of characters that serves as your public key for receiving Bitcoin payments. To generate a Bitcoin address, follow these steps:
1. Open your Bitcoin wallet.
2. Look for the "Receive" or "Add Address" option.
3. Click on the option to generate a new address.
4. Your Bitcoin wallet will generate a new address, which will be displayed as a string of alphanumeric characters.
Step 4: Create a QR Code
Now that you have your Bitcoin address, you can create a QR code for it. Here's how:
1. Open a QR code generator online or use a mobile app that can generate QR codes.
2. Enter your Bitcoin address in the designated field.
3. Choose the desired QR code size and format.
4. Generate the QR code.
Step 5: Save or Share Your Bitcoin Wallet QR Code
Once you have generated the QR code, you can save it to your device or share it with others. If you plan to use the QR code for receiving Bitcoin payments, you can print it out or display it on a digital screen. Make sure to keep your QR code secure and only share it with trusted individuals.
In conclusion, obtaining a Bitcoin wallet QR code is a straightforward process. By following these steps, you can easily create a QR code for your Bitcoin wallet and receive Bitcoin payments with ease. Remember to choose a reliable Bitcoin wallet and keep your private keys secure to ensure the safety of your digital assets.
